Men’s Lacrosse Ends Regular Season With Win

Box Score BRISTOL, R.I. – The Roger Williams University Men's Lacrosse ended the regular season with an 18-9 win over Wentworth Institute of Technology Tuesday afternoon.
 
Wentworth opened with back-to-back goals by Chris Quinn in the first two minutes of the game, leading to a Roger Williams timeout. After the short break, Roger Williams responded with consecutive goals by Justin MacIntyre (Norwalk, Conn.) to tie the game at two apiece. Then Jude Marzec (West Islip, N.Y.) logged three straight goals in less than a minute to quick put RWU up 5-2.
 
Max Cammarota (Redding, Conn.) and AJ Core (Syosset, N.Y.) combined for three more scores in the final three minutes of play in the opening quarter to give RWU an 8-2 lead. In the following period, both teams' offense stalled, as the only goal in the quarter came from a misplayed ball back into the Leopards' own goal. Roger Williams would take a 9-2 advantage going into halftime.
 
Matt Larsen (Northborough, Mass.) and Kevin Butler (Jefferson, Mass.) ended the scoring drought for Wentworth in the period, but the Hawks tallied six goals in the quarter to build the lead to 15-4 entering the final quarter.
 
Wentworth's offense began to pick up in the final period, scoring five times in the quarter including closing the game on a 4-0 run in the final eight minutes of play. However, the deficit was too much to overcome as RWU picked up the win.
 
Core notched six points on four goals and two assists, while Cammarota added five points on two goals and three assists. Shawn Errasti (Duxbury, Mass.) finished with eight ground balls and three caused turnovers. Dolan Jones (Levittown, N.Y.) made four saves in the win.
 
Butler (3 G), Larsen (1 G, 2 A), and Mike Coakley (Flemington, N.J.) [1 G, 2 A] each finished with three points for Wentworth. Adam Dufault (Lexington, Mass.) had six saves in the loss.
 
Roger Williams (9-7, 5-3 CCC) hosts Curry in the CCC Quarterfinals on Saturday, while Wentworth ends the year at 6-10, 1-7 CCC.
